Adam B. Kaufman (Co-founder Emeritus)

Adam B. Kaufman was the first male in the history of Muhlenberg College to minor in dance. Prominent stage roles include the Gravedigger in Hamlet, Ali Hakim in Oklahoma!, and Mark Anthony in A Chorus Line. Since college he has choreographed his own modern dance show and relocated to NYC, where he has appeared as an extra on Oz, Law and Order, Ed, Death to Smoochy, and The Guru. He’s been involved in nearly every Porch Room project, and was seen in Five-Cornered Thinking, Burt Reynolds’ Amazing..., and The White Knight, as well as cowrote and directed At the SAG Registry. He also recently choreographed a dance piece for the first Alumni Choreographed Dance Show at Muhlenberg College, and can be seen annually during the holiday season as an elf at the famous FAO Schwarz on New York City’s 5th Avenue.
